Neotrygon romeoi [Neotrygon romeoi]

Description

This stingray is typically encountered in coastal habitats where it cruises close to the seafloor. With a low, stealthy profile, it may partially bury or hover over the bottom, and divers can sometimes spot it by its distinctive shape and slow, graceful wingbeats.
